TAMPA, Fla. — Operating the federally supported vaccine sites without extra help from the National Guard or outside state nurses would be a logistical nightmare, according to local health officials.
“I don’t think we have enough people to run the site without help,” said Dr. Michael Teng.
According to the Florida Department of Health, most of the people working at the FEMA sites were deployed here because of Gov. Ron Desantis’ executive order. The extra help is the reason more than 27 percent of Floridians are fully vaccinated. ....

Business Insider spoke to a few doctors, nurses, and paramedical staff from various parts of the country.
This unprecedented situation has restricted them to even meet their family, making it all the more difficult.Drowned in the cries for help from the patients and their kin ⁠ daily new COVID-19 cases in India has crossed 3 lakh ⁠ is the clarion call from the country s doctors, nurses and volunteers who are combating the virus daily.
According to the Indian government, around 174 doctors, 116 nurses and 199 health workers have died until February this year. A year ago, they had a different challenge. Many of the health workers were getting ostracised and even attacked for working with COVID-19 infected patients. The situation has changed but not necessaril ....
